Also consider that those dollars in 1981 are worth maybe 3 and a half of our dollars today. So for a $249 pocket computer, which I have fond memories of. Assume that 16 K memory device would cost about, let's say, $800 today.
That makes a much stronger impression of how much cheaper hardware has become, as well as more capable.
